WebThermal fluid heaters, also known as hot oil heaters, are used to heat fluids in a closed loop system. They work by using a heat transfer fluid, typically a mineral oil or synthetic oil, that is heated by a burner. WebCondensing Tankless System. Uses two heat exchangers. Secondary heat exchanger captures extra heat before it escapes into the vent system. Extra heat is transferred to heat incoming water that flows through primary heat exchanger. Efficiency rating is generally in the mid 90% range, about 10-15% higher than a noncondensing tankless unit. Go ...

They are used to heat materials and maintain thermal equilibrium in a variety of settings. Thermal fluid systems use a closed loop system to circulate a heating fluid through a series of heat exchangers. Geothermal heat pumps (GHPs), sometimes referred to as GeoExchange, earth-coupled, ground-source, or water-source heat pumps, have been in use since the late 1940s.
